3. Cardano (ADA)
After stalling below $0.90-$0.95 resistance, ADA now trades around $0.86. The dip has shaken out weak hands, but behind the price action, the network has been expanding.
As of Q2 2025, Cardano’s Plutus-based smart contracts have surpassed 17,000 deployments, which shows its dApps ecosystem is strong. Its Hydra scaling solution is also rolling out, which aims to bring transaction throughput into the thousands per second. Critics say Cardano moves too carefully, but the same rigor gives it credibility.

4. VeChain (VET)
VeChain is one of those projects that rarely makes headlines, yet it keeps signing deals. Currently priced around $0.02, it’s easily overlooked, but its adoption tells another story.
VeChain partnered with BMW to expand blockchain-based vehicle tracking and added more supply-chain verification pilots with European luxury brands. Many coins fight for attention in DeFi, but VeChain has created a space in real-world enterprise solutions.

5. Stellar (XLM)
Trading at $0.38, Stellar is positioning itself as the bridge between banks and blockchain. In early 2025, the Stellar Development Foundation partnered with AEON to make cross-border transfers faster and cheaper for millions of workers sending money home.
With near-instant transactions and almost zero fees, XLM stands out as a practical alternative to costly systems like Western Union or SWIFT. As global remittances grow into a trillion-dollar market, Stellar’s current low price looks like an opportunity.
